优先级参数配对组合测试集生成策略 被引量:2

Parameter Pair-wise Testing Set Generation Strategy with Prioritization

摘要 在参数组合测试的实际应用中,时间或预算等原因可能导致无法运行整个测试集,造成重要测试案例的漏执行。该文引用优先级权值的思想为测试案例设置优先级,介绍2种生成有序的配对组合覆盖测试集的方法,不论测试在何时中断,都可确保最重要的测试已被运行。 In many applications of interaction testing, the whole testing set can not be run completely due to time or budget constraints, so that some important tests are missed. This paper drives weight for each value of each parameter, sets priority for each test and adapts two different methods to generate an ordered pair-wise coverage testing set. No matter how tests are stoped at any intermediate point, interactions deemed most important tests are tested.
